HIS Recreational classes are offered for students 3-college just starting out or who are interested in taking a variety of classes offered with a one day per week commitment. Weekly classes in Ballet, Tap, Jazz, Hip Hop, Lyrical or Contemporary may be taken on their own however, Graded Technique Ballet students may take recreational classes at 50% off in order to round out their training! All students participate in the Spring Student Showcase on May 12, 2012. Recreational students will receive training that gives them the oppportunity to move into Graded Technique classes as they advance but are not required to do so.
Level II-V. Students receive excellent pre-professional training in Ballet with additional Contemporary classes. Proper technique and body positions are taught, while keeping perspective on the unique and beautiful bodies that God has given to them. Ballet evaluations are held every spring for advancement through the various levels. Levels II and above attend technique classes two to five times per week at their convenience and have the option to participate in the Spring Student Showcase on May 12, 2012. 
** Boys may attend free of charge.

Ensemble, a performing outreach division of Hearts In Step, is available to all students in our Graded Technique divisions Levels II-V.  The Ensemble provides an excellent opportunity for students to supplement their pre-professional training and minister through dance.  Through a year long commitment, students perform original repertoire  at community events and an original H.I.S. story ballet consisting of a variety of dance styles on March 17, 2012.

Hearts In Step strives to provide an environment where excellence in dance is taught, while developing talent and building Christian character. To this end, all classes include group prayer and devotion time.
Throughout the year a common Bible curriculum is taught to all ages and levels. The year is culminated with a Spring Showcase that is based on the Bible theme of the year and an original story ballet put on for the community by our Ensemble members. We offer a nine month program running September-May.
